WebThe oldest recorded red-breasted merganser was 9 years and 4 months old. A female was also recorded breeding when she was 8 years old. Like many animals, most red-breasted merganser hatchlings do not survive through their first year. Up to 50% of hatchlings die because of exposure to cold weather, another 25% are preyed on. WebThe red-breasted merganser is a duck species that is native to much of the Northern Hemisphere. The red breast that gives the species its common name is only displayed by males in breeding plumage. Individuals fly rapidly, and feed by diving from the surface to pursue aquatic animals underwater, using serrated bills to capture slippery fish. WebThe red-breasted merganser is a medium-sized diving duck that belongs to a group known as sawbills. It is an elegant streamlined bird with a body shape adapted well for swimming, and a long serrated bill that helps it catch and hold on to fish, which make up the majority of its diet.
